代码随想录算法训练营day46|| 第八章 动态规划

139.单词拆分

给你一个字符串 s 和一个字符串列表 wordDict 作为字典。请你判断是否可以利用字典中出现的单词拼接出 s 。题目

class Solution {
public:
    bool wordBreak(string s, vector& wordDict) {
        unordered_set wordSet(wordDict.begin(),wordDict.end());
        vector dp(s.size()+1,false);
        dp[0]=true;
        for(int i=0;i<=s.size();i++){
            for(int j=0;j

你可能感兴趣的:(算法,动态规划,数据结构)